Thiruvanchoor Radhakrishnan Elected as Speaker of Kerala Assembly

In the recent elections for the position of Speaker, Thiruvanchoor of the Indian National Congress secured a decisive victory, receiving 101 votes. By contrast, A.C. Moideen, representing the Opposition Left Democratic Front (LDF), garnered 35 votes, while B.B. Gopakumar from the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P)-led National Democratic Alliance (NDA) received 3 votes.

Following the election results, the Speaker officially recognized Pinarayi Vijayan as the Leader of the Opposition. Vijayan is the Chief Minister of Kerala and a prominent figure in the LDF. The election results reflect the prevailing political dynamics within the assembly, highlighting the strength of the Congress party in this session.
